What is the Hunts Point Fish Market?

The Hunts Point Fish Market is a major wholesale seafood market located in the Bronx, New York City. It is one of the largest seafood distribution centers in the world, supplying fresh and frozen fish and seafood to restaurants, markets, and businesses throughout the region. The market operates in the early morning hours and is known for its wide variety of seafood from around the globe. It plays a crucial role in the city's food supply chain and is an important employer in the area.

What are some common challenges faced by workers at Hunts Point Fish Market, and how can new employees prepare for them?

Employees at the Hunts Point Fish Market often face challenges such as working in cold, wet environments, handling heavy products, and adhering to strict health and safety regulations. The workday typically starts very early in the morning and involves collaborating closely with a team to process, pack, and distribute seafood efficiently. New hires can prepare by investing in appropriate waterproof and insulated gear, developing good time management habits, and familiarizing themselves with food safety standards. Teamwork and adaptability are key to thriving in this fast-paced, physically demanding setting.

POSITION SUMMARY
At San Pedro Fish Market, the Fish Monger is responsible for ensuring that our fresh fish is properly cleaned, filleted
and displayed while helping the company attain the highest levels of quality control and guest service. This position
must follow directions from management and multi-task efficiently. All position responsibilities must be performed
in accordance with city, state, federal and Company policy.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

Provide guests with excellent customer service, offering assistance whenever necessary.

Scale, gut and fillet fresh fish and seafood and properly defrost frozen product.

Assist with setting up seafood display case ensuring product is rotated properly and the case is

visually appealing to guests.

Maintain appropriate seafood par levels, ensuring the availability of fresh product to maximize sales

and minimize waste.

Prepare components of each dish on our menu using our established San Pedro Fish Market recipes.

Practice safe knife and food handling skills

Load and unload inventory keeping the back area, refrigeration units and freezers clean, safe and

organized.

Perform opening, closing and side work ensuring that the opening and closing checklists are properly

completed and maintained.

Retain and provide information and recommendations about our seafood selections including origin

and flavor profile.

Keep an accurate and balanced cash register.

Maintain a clean and properly sanitized work station.
